-6 overtimes. That's what it took for Syracuse to knock off UConn in the Big East quarterfinals last night/this morning at Madison Square Garden in New York City. I have posted the highlights from ESPN.com because I can't describe this game any better than they did.

-Mark McGwire did a rare interview with the New York Times for today's edition. In the interview McGwire talks about his role as a hitting tutor for 4 current MLB players. McGwire agreed to the interview only when told he would not be asked about the steroid controversy.

-Ho, hum, just another triple double for LeBron James. The Cavs won for the first time in the LeBron era at Phoenix last night. James scored 34 points, dished 13 assists, and grabbed 10 rebounds. This may be the only guy in the league that could average a triple-double for an entire season. This was his 3rd consecutive triple-double.

-Michael Phelps did an interview with NBC that will air on Dateline this Sunday night. In the interview Phelps talks about the night where he was photographed smoking out of a bong. Phelps apologized for the photo, but never acknowledged that he was smoking marijuanna out of the device.
